Field service technicians function in potentially unsafe conditions, and need to adhere to strict policies from OSHA that require donning individual safety devices (PPE) the entire duration of a cleanup work. This suggests wearing a special body fit, booties, a number of layers of handwear covers and a respirator at all times throughout the clean-up process.


Sometimes, workers experience clean-up work in homes without cooling, and in the summertime warm, this can be particularly uneasy or perhaps hazardous. Other than the physical needs of the job, the psychological aspect is equally, if not even more, demanding. An expert in this industry must be able to reveal compassion without concentrating on the unfavorable.


It is crucial that workers concentrate exclusively on the job at hand, with regard to aiding the household. Andrew claims that from his experience, he has seen it is harder for most individuals to get made use of to the psychological side of the task than the actual scenes. "Seeing households in their time of need can be tougher to take care of than the real scene.

Possible biohazards are plentiful in the clinical area and those managing them should act with caution. Right here are some instances of biohazards: Blood, blood items, amniotic liquid, or other physical fluid that can send disease. Droppings that might contain infections and bacteria, carcasses that might contain disease-carrying flies or rodents, and bedding materials from infected animals.

Home and business owners need to not get rid of unsafe products themselves. Lawful charges may use if inappropriate disposal happens. Blood and bodily fluid residue Pet waste or continues to be Hoarding scenarios Suicide or death Crime scenes Chemical risks Virus contamination or illness break outs Sewage contamination Mold and mildew or fungus invasion Educated professionals understand exactly how to determine and deal with biohazards making use of the proper personal safety devices (PPE) and the OSHA Bloodborne Pathogens standard. Clean-up may require hazmat suits, handwear covers, respirators, face shields, and much more.


Everything about Biohazard Cleaning Services


The clean-up procedure additionally needs meticulous interest to information. Every last trace of the biohazard should be located and cleaned up to remediate the threat.


Permeable products need to be eliminated based on industry criteria and state laws. Dangerous clinical waste handling should adhere to OSHA laws, and anything needing disposal goes to a dangerous medical waste incinerator.


Walls and floor covering in some cases requires sealing to cover any type of continuing to be discolorations. Biohazard clean-up is unavoidably destructive. Drywall and floorboards normally need elimination. Repair experts will certainly do their ideal not to worsen the loss of residential property for home or entrepreneur. Specialist business additionally function to manage biohazard cleanup with compassion and treatment, particularly when dealing with stressful scenarios.

N-95 respirator shields against dust, mites and various other little airborne particles. Commonly used in labs while collaborating with infected organic materials. Half-mask respirator proactively filterings system air and shields against communicable diseases, fumes and harmful chemicals. Full-face respirator used in similar circumstances as the half-mask, but with added security for learn this here now the eyes and face.


Fundamental safety and security goggles shield from projectiles yet not efficient against sprinkling. Chemical splash safety glasses these safety glasses have suction that fit around the eyes to protect from particles and chemical splashes. Face shield face guards shield the entire face from particles, projectiles, and dashes of any type of kind. They're generally worn over chemical splash safety glasses for added defense and are made use of when taking care of highly harmful materials.
